Differences Between GOG and Steam Versions While the core gameplay remains identical, there are technical distinctions for GOG users:
- DRM-Free: The GOG version does not require the GOG Galaxy client to launch or play, offering a standalone executable.
- Multiplayer: GOG players can play multiplayer via LAN or Direct IP connection. However, they cannot use the Steam "Quick Match" server browser.
- Cross-Play: Multiplayer cross-play between Steam and GOG is possible but can be finicky. Both players must be on the exact same version number. Because Steam updates automatically and GOG installers are manual, version mismatches are a common issue for cross-play.
- Steam Workshop: The GOG version does not have native access to the Steam Workshop. Players looking to install mods (such as tModLoader) must manually install them or use the external tModLoader application, which requires more configuration than the Steam version's one-click subscription service.

Installation and Version Management
GOG users have two primary ways to manage their version 1.4.4.9 installation:
GOG Galaxy: The GOG Galaxy client acts as a standard launcher, providing automatic updates and cloud saves.
Offline Installers: One of GOG's best features is the standalone installer. You can download the 1.4.4.9 setup files from your GOG account library to keep as a permanent backup or for installation on machines without internet access. Multiplayer on GOG v1.4.4.9
Multiplayer works differently on GOG because it lacks the "Join via Steam" integration. terraria 1449 gog
Cross-Play (Steam & GOG): GOG players can play with Steam players on version 1.4.4.9. However, you cannot use the Steam friend list to join.
Connection Method: You must use the "Join via IP" method. The host needs to provide their external IP address and ensure Port Forwarding (typically port 7777) is set up on their router.
Dedicated Servers: For the most stable 1.4.4.9 experience, using the Terraria Server software (included in your GOG installation folder as TerrariaServer.exe) is recommended for hosting. Modding with tModLoader

Backing up and migrating saves
- Save files are typically stored in:
- Windows: My Documents/My Games/Terraria
- macOS and Linux: platform-dependent paths under user folders
- Copy the Worlds and Players folders to a safe location before applying updates that might alter save file structure.
- To move saves between installations, copy these folders to the corresponding directory on the destination machine.

The Terraria 1.4.4.9 update (released November 17, 2022) was a major hotfix and balancing patch for the "Labor of Love" era. On GOG, it is available as a DRM-free offline installer, though updates may occasionally lag slightly behind the Steam version due to the manual upload process. Core Update Features (v1.4.4.9)
The 1.4.4.9 patch focused on polishing visual assets and finalising balance changes before the shift toward the upcoming 1.4.5 content.
Sprite Modernization: Over 100 item sprites were updated to modern standards. This included resizing roughly 90 swords and tools to match their actual in-game hitbox size, reducing pixel distortion. Balance Tweaks: Morning Star: Damage reduced from 180 to 165.
Xeno Staff: Fire rate reduced (attack delay increased from 36 to 40).
Scarecrows: Kill requirement for Bestiary/Banner reduced from 200 to 150.
Shimmer Adjustments: Recorded Music Boxes thrown into Shimmer now transmute back to blank ones.
Bug Fixes: Addressed issues like Glow Tulips failing to generate in some worlds and fixes for multiplayer item duplication. GOG-Specific Details
